That's for an 85h month. Overtime for FOs is AED 515/h.
You may be missing the other quantifiable benefits.
-Company provided accommodation (4 bedroom villa with utilities) or housing allowance if you own property in Dubai and opt out of company provided (Around 15k AED per month for FOs).
-Health and dental coverage for the whole family.
-Layover allowance (between $60-100 per hotel night depending on the destination).
-Emirates Platinum card pretty big discounts.
-Loss of license insurance.
-End of service benefit.
-Provident fund.
-Kids education allowance (40-60K aed per annum per child below 20 years old).
If you add everything together it's around 11K-12K € for FOs on average.
